List of West Indies Test cricketers
This is a list of West Indian Test cricketers. A Test match is an international cricket match between two of the leading cricketing nations. The list is arranged in the order in which each player won his Test cap. Those players who won their first Test cap in the same Test match as other players who had such a win, are listed alphabetically by surname.
Statistics are correct as of 8 July 2012.
Notes:
*1Sammy Guillen also played Test cricket for New Zealand. Only his record for the West Indies is given above.
*2Brian Lara has also played Test cricket for the ICC World XI. Only his record for the West Indies is given above.
